100 Proof (Aged in Soul) is an American soul group formed in Detroit, Michigan,
in 1969. The group was assembled by the former Motown songwriting team
Holland-Dozier-Holland and signed to their new label Hot Wax Records. Their
breakthrough came with the release of "Somebody's Been Sleeping", which reached
number 8 on the Billboard Hot 100 and sold over one million copies, earning a
gold certification from the Recording Industry Association of America in 1970.
